Matchmaking is based on TrueSkill, Estimated Latency, Skill, and the presence of DLC.
This is for an ‘ideal’ match. If an ideal match cannot be determined, an ‘acceptable’ match is decided instead.
The acceptable match has no requirements on latency or skill (however a best-case lobby is still selected).

If they’ve stayed true to past Halo games 343 uses trueskill and on a playlist by playlist basis. That means that regardless of what you play there’s always the chance you’ll see some severely undervalued player making their way up the ranks despite great performance elsewhere.
